Tips to Make Your Ebook Web Site PAY YOU BACK!
There are lots of ways to create
revenue from your website. But everyone has
to start somewhere. Use these seven tips to
get started making your website pay you back
for your investments of time and money:
1.
Find a Niche
Look for something about your
business that's special--different. You can
use that special difference to help promote
your business with increased customer awareness
and loyalty. People tend to find products and
services interesting that are unique. They talk
about them and tell their friends about them.
2.
Prepare to Put In the Time
I dislike being the one to tell
you. But you are going to have to put in the
time necessary to see the rewards. Despite what
many self-proclaimed gurus will tell you, there
really is no instant way to make money on the
net. Successful web businesses know they reap
the benefits as a result of constant development,
refinement and hard work.
3.
Get Real, Market and Advertise
Whoever
told you "Build it and they will come."
lives on the set of "Field of Dreams"
starring Kevin Costner. Anyway, know your customers
won't just come to you. You have to go get them.
Use and test online/offline methods to see which
works best for you. Then synch them all together.
i.e. make sure all your print materials have
your website address on them.

Change is Good In Web Site Marketing
Is your web site working for you? Take a long
hard look at your site. Or ask a friend to give
you a brutally honest review of your site. Does
it pass the test of clarity and professionalism?
Are
the graphics of good quality and clear? Do the
formatting, font size and font colors work together
to deliver a readable understandable message?
Is your message consistent throughout the site?
Or does your site commit design mistakes that
speak UNPROFESSIONAL as soon as it loads?
There are some common mistakes website owners
make that may cause visitors to leave early.
Correct these simple mistakes to make sure your
visitors stay long enough to read your important
message.
1. Too Complex.
Simplicity is good. Start with a simple website.
Don't load your web site with a lot of high
tech clutter. Your visitors may miss your whole
sales message.
2.
Too Wordy.
Make every word count. Don't use unnecessary
words or phrases on your site. You only have
so much time to get your visitor's attention
and interest.
3.
No Pictures, Examples or Testimonials.
Use descriptive words, pictures and examples
(testimonials.) Take the time to get your point
across. Don't make the mistake that everyone
will totally understand your web site message.
4.
Too Few Mentions of Solution Benefits.
Repeat your strongest benefit Repeat it at least
3 times because some people may miss it. In
other words, don't write your strongest point
or benefit only once.
5.
Create sections.
Don't push all your words together on your web
site. People like to skim; use plenty of headings
and sub headings.
